  • FirePro V4900 has 36% more power consumption, than GeForce GTX 760A.
  • FirePro V4900 is connected by PCIe 2.0 x16, and GeForce GTX 760A uses PCIe 3.0 x16 interface.
  • GeForce GTX 760A has 1 GB more memory, than FirePro V4900.
  • Both cards are used in Desktops.
  • FirePro V4900 is build with TeraScale 2 architecture, and GeForce GTX 760A - with Kepler.
  • Core clock speed of FirePro V4900 is 172 MHz higher, than GeForce GTX 760A.
  • FirePro V4900 is manufactured by 40 nm process technology, and GeForce GTX 760A - by 28 nm process technology.
  • Memory clock speed of GeForce GTX 760A is 8 MHz higher, than FirePro V4900.
